Firepower 7115, 7125, and AMP7150 SFP Socket Activity/Link LEDs
Description
For an inline interface: the light is on when the interface has activity. If dark,
there is no activity.
For a passive interface: the light is non-functional.
For an inline or passive interface: the light is on when the interface has link.
If dark, there is no link.
